Patent number: 12252882Abstract: A system for insulating a curtain wall structure is disclosed. The system includes a plurality of insulation hangers, a curtain wall insulation, and a safing insulation. The insulation hangers include a reinforcing member that engages a horizontal transom of the curtain wall structure. The system is attached only to horizontal transoms of the curtain wall structure via the insulation hangers to provide ease of installation and/or enhanced reliability.Type: GrantFiled: October 14, 2024Date of Patent: March 18, 2025Assignee: Owens Corning Intellectual Capital, LLCInventors: Jack Long, Angela Ogino, Michael Szajna

Patent number: 12208605Abstract: A method for making a laminated glazing panel is described. A bolt having a head portion and a stem portion extending therefrom is positioned in a hole in a sheet of glazing material so that a first surface of the head portion is faces in the direction of a first major surface of the sheet of glazing material and the stem portion extends beyond a second major surface of the sheet of glazing material. A sheet of adhesive interlayer material is positioned on the first major surface of the sheet of glazing material to cover the first surface of the head portion. Suitable lamination conditions are used to laminate the sheet of adhesive interlayer material to the sheet of glazing material. During lamination, fluid trapped between the first surface of the head portion and the sheet of adhesive interlayer material is removed via a fluid pathway associated with the stem portion. Laminated glazing panels made using the method are also described.Type: GrantFiled: January 27, 2021Date of Patent: January 28, 2025Assignee: Pilkington Group LimitedInventor: Michael John Davidson

Patent number: 12018497Abstract: A masonry veneer wall cladding system may include a first layer of a ceramic based veneer, such as formed steel calcium silicate, and a second layer that is formed of a rigid thermal insulation panel such as an expanded foam. The two layers are bonded together with an air gap between the layers. The panels are mounted to supporting wall structure with wall support mounting fittings, or cleats. The fittings have a first leg and a second leg, and a web connecting the two legs. The first leg has slots for mechanical fasteners. The slots permit the fitting to slide, so a panel can be put in place, and then the fitting, or cleat can slide down to trap the panel in place. The panel has accommodations for the engaging fingers of the cleat. In one embodiment, the air gap can define the accommodation.Type: GrantFiled: June 12, 2019Date of Patent: June 25, 2024Assignee: Fero CorporationInventor: Michael Hatzinikolas

Patent number: 11933039Abstract: A mounting and alignment system for building panels. A mounting bracket comprises a lower component affixable to a building support and an upper component from which a panel can be hung. A bearing assembly between the upper and lower components transfers load from the upper component to the lower component and allows the horizontal position of the upper component and thereby the panel to be easily adjusted. Mullion guides on the sides and extending over the panel top interact with mullion guides on other panels and automatically adjust the horizontal position of a panel as the panel is lowed in place from a relatively large horizontal placement tolerance a smaller placement tolerance required for other interacting structures on adjacent sides of installed panel. After the panel is installed, mullion guides on the adjacent panel sides can be removed.Type: GrantFiled: September 9, 2021Date of Patent: March 19, 2024Assignee: ASSEMBLY OSM, INC.Inventors: Andrea Vittadini, Alessandro Massarotto, Marco Zardetto, Luca Andreetta, Sameer Kumar, Matt Kirkham

Patent number: 11719012Abstract: A curtain wall panel mounting system comprises a ball anchor seated in a spherical cavity or a cylindrical cavity with plugs nearly abutting the ball of the anchor. A stem extends from the ball to connect to the wall panel. Under seismic stress, the ball may swivel within the cavity so as to pivot the anchor, allowing the attached wall panel to angle itself to accommodate the stress.Type: GrantFiled: January 21, 2020Date of Patent: August 8, 2023Inventor: Michael William Richard

Patent number: 11668090Abstract: A window wall system includes a plurality of window wall modules for forming at least in part a facade of a building. Each window wall module is connected between two consecutive concrete slabs of the building and includes a bottom rail, a top rail, two vertical mullions, and a window panel. The system also includes a plurality of anchoring brackets for connecting the bottom rail of each window wall module to a respective one of the concrete slabs, and a plurality of preformed sealing membranes. Each anchoring bracket is configured to be affixed to a top surface of the respective one of the concrete slabs. Each sealing membrane sealingly engages the bottom rail of a corresponding window wall module. Each sealing membrane is interlocked with a respective one of the anchoring brackets to retain the sealing membrane in place. Each sealing membrane is made of an elastomeric material.Type: GrantFiled: November 3, 2020Date of Patent: June 6, 2023Assignee: A. & D.
